Spotted Seal
Chinese:斑海豹
English:Spotted Seal
Latin:Phoca largha
The Spotted Seals live in ice floes and waters of the North Pacific Ocean and adjacent seas. An adult seal generally weighs between 81 to 109kg and measures from 1.5 to 2.1m. The head of a spotted seal is round, with a narrow snout resembling that of a dog.
